Position Responsibilities :
- Follows principles of medical ethics for medical assistant
- Prepare patients for radiological procedures and take X-rays following established procedures for patient care and safety
- Assists patients any time need is apparent or as directed by supervisory staff
- Performs medical assistant and radiological procedures
- Assists the providers with patients, including preparing patients and the examination rooms, taking initial medical history for the chart, taking vital signs, and explaining the process to the patients
- Assist provider in all special procedures, including minor surgery, as required
- Performs x-rays as directed by the provider
- Gives instructions to patients as instructed by provider
- Assists with any procedures that have been taught through formal training or by physician
- Keeps medical records in accordance with procedures and forms
- Follows HIPAA guidelines for patient confidentiality
- Keeps rooms stocked with adequate medical supplies, washes and dries instruments used, and prepares sterilization as required
- Clean wounds, draws labs, electrocardiograms and applies dressings and splints as directed by provider
- Assists in lab procedures under the supervision of provider and for which training has been given. Other duties may consist of notifying patients of lab results, giving vaccines, immunizations and medications prescribed by the doctor; lab work consisting of throat cultures, hematocrits, and urinalysis
- Responsible for proper handling and storage of all medications stored in the office
- Performs other admin related duties as assigned
- Completes required trainings as assigned by the organization
- Ability to help assist with front office duties as needed / requested
- Cross train between front office and mid office responsibilities as needed to ensure a synced clinic
- Completes other job duties as assigned
- Regularly interacts with providers / team members / patients via face to face or electronically
